Pontypool & New Inn train station, located in the picturesque area of Torfaen, South Wales, is a charming station that serves as a gateway to both local and long-distance destinations. Whether you're a commuter, a traveller seeking adventure, or simply someone who enjoys a scenic ride to work, this station might just be the stopover you need on your journey. Set amidst a landscape that blends the past with the present, the station offers a unique blend of accessibility and character.
Although Pontypool & New Inn may not boast extensive facilities, it does provide essential services for travellers.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ets. These machines cater to various payment methods, though it's important to note that cash is not accepted. Worried about access and support? The station is equipped with customer help points for immediate assistance at platforms and a help point for more extensive inquiries. Unfortunately, step-free access is limited due to a flight of 24 steps leading to the platforms, so travellers with mobility challenges should plan accordingly.
If you are someone who enjoys cycling, you'll be happy to know there are 14 cycle parking spaces available, spread across two locations for your convenience. However, the station lacks amenities like toilets, waiting rooms, and refreshment facilities. On the security side, there is CCTV monitoring to ensure passenger safety.
Though options are somewhat limited, transport links to and from Pontypool & New Inn station keep it connected to the broader area. A rail replacement bus service is available, and there's a PlusBus option that offers discounted bus travel in Pontypool. Details of these options are accessible via the PlusBus website. Additionally, while b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, bringing your bicycle is made easy with the existing storage facilities.

Lingwood Train Station may have a small footprint, but it doesn't compromise on the essentials. If you're purchasing a ticket, fear not—though there's no ticket office, you can easily buy and collect your tickets from the available machines. These machines are accessible, ensuring everyone can get their journey underway with minimal fuss. For those who need it, an induction loop is available to assist with hearing requirements.
Safety and information are priorities at Lingwood, with customer help points located throughout the station, making it easy to get any assistance or information you might need. While there are no waiting rooms, you'll find seating areas to rest while you wait for your train. Unfortunately, the station lacks some modern conveniences such as toilets, Wi-Fi, and refreshment facilities, inviting passengers to enjoy the simple pleasure of the journey itself.
Travel at Lingwood Train Station goes beyond the railway tracks, offering seamless integration to other forms of transport. For rare instances when trains are unavailable, a rail replacement bus service operates just past the nearby level crossing by the Kings Head Freehouse.
